day 324: Amityville Horror house
If you don’t know about the true story of the Ametiyville Horror, it goes something like this: George and Kathleen Lutz and their three children moved into a house in Amityville, Long Island, New York. They did so knowing full well that thirteen months before, Ronald DeFeo, Jr. had shot and killed six members of his family at the house. After 28 days, the Lutzes left the house, claiming to have been terrorized by paranormal phenomena while living there. Numerous of books and films have been made from this story.
